Seiichiro Shimamura
About Seiichiro Shimamura
Seiichiro Shimamura is the Vice President of Corporate Planning at Asurion, with a background in business development, customer care, and marketing.
Current Role at Asurion
Seiichiro Shimamura currently serves as Vice President, Corporate Planning at Asurion. He has held this position since 2015, bringing extensive experience in strategic planning and corporate initiatives to the Nashville, Tennessee-based company.
Previous Positions at Asurion
Before his current role, Seiichiro Shimamura was Vice President of Business Development and Customer Care at Asurion from 2014 to 2015. He initially joined Asurion in 2013 as Director of Customer Care, where he spent one year. These roles enabled him to hone his expertise in customer service management and business development.
Role at AIG
Prior to his tenure at Asurion, Seiichiro Shimamura worked at AIG, holding the position of Vice President, Head of Operations and Customer Relations from 2010 to 2012 in New York. Earlier, from 2007 to 2010, he was the Marketing Director, specializing in Direct Marketing and Sponsorship Marketing. These roles provided him with a solid foundation in operational management and marketing strategies.
Educational Background
Seiichiro Shimamura studied at Musashi University, where he earned his bachelor's degree in Economics from 1986 to 1990. His academic background in economics has equipped him with the analytical skills necessary for his various corporate planning and operational roles.
